How to hire a landscaping pro in Cyprus

  1. Get quotes from established firms serving the villa market (Paphos, Limassol) — the market is small and reputation-driven
  2. Prefer VAT-registered companies with written contracts for project work, especially if you're buying from abroad
  3. Design water-first: drip irrigation, drought-tolerant Mediterranean planting, and gravel/hard surfaces suit the climate; thirsty lawns are a running cost commitment
  4. Check municipal/district rules for boundary walls and any structural work — permits apply to walls and structures as part of building regulations
  5. Confirm materials provenance — local stone is cost-effective; imported materials carry island logistics premiums
  6. Agree staged payments tied to milestones
  7. For rural plots, confirm land boundaries before walls or fences — boundary disputes are a known hazard

Cyprus has no landscaping licence; building permits apply to walls and structures under district building regulations. The practical consumer protections are choosing VAT-registered firms, written contracts, and staged payments — particularly important in the expat villa market where absentee owners commission work remotely.

Frequently asked questions

How long does a landscaping project take?

A planting refresh: 1-3 days. A patio or new lawn: 3-7 days. A full garden rebuild: 2-6 weeks depending on size and weather. Add lead time — good landscapers in Limassol book out weeks or months ahead in spring. Weather delays are normal for excavation and paving; a realistic contractor builds buffer into the schedule rather than promising exact dates.

How much does landscaping cost?

Landscaping is project work priced by scope, not time. The two big cost drivers are hardscape share (paving, walls, decking cost 2-4x planting per unit area) and access (tight access means hand-carrying materials). A planting-only refresh sits at the bottom of the range; a full redesign with paving, lighting, and irrigation sits at the top. Get itemised quotes so you can see where the money goes.

How do I check a landscaper is legitimate?

Look for: an established business with reviewable past projects (ask to see one in person or talk to a past client), public liability insurance, itemised written quotes, and no pressure tactics. In markets with trade licensing, verify the licence covers the structural work quoted. Photos of 'their work' prove nothing — completed local references do.

When is the best time of year to book landscaping?

Construction (paving, decking, walls) suits the drier months; planting establishes best in the local planting season (autumn or spring in most climates). The booking sweet spot is the off-season: quotes are keener, scheduling faster, and your project is ready to enjoy when the good weather arrives. Spring inquiries in Limassol hit peak-demand pricing.

What's the difference between softscape and hardscape, and why does it matter for price?

Softscape is living material — turf, plants, trees, soil. Hardscape is built structure — patios, paths, walls, decks, pergolas. Hardscape typically costs 2-4x more per square metre because it involves excavation, sub-bases, and skilled construction. Shifting your design 20% from hardscape to planting is the single biggest lever for cutting a landscaping quote.

What does new turf or a new lawn cost?

Turf is priced per square metre installed, and ground preparation is most of the cost — stripping old grass, levelling, importing topsoil, then laying. Seed costs a fraction of turf but takes a season to establish. Beware quotes that skip soil prep: turf on unprepared ground looks fine for weeks, then fails patchily.

What does landscaping cost in Cyprus?

Finished landscaping runs roughly €40-€150 per m² depending on hardscape share — well below northern Europe on labour, though imported materials narrow the gap. A typical villa garden build lands at €3,000-€20,000; gravel-and-drip Mediterranean designs at the lower end, lawn-and-paving designs at the upper.

Should I install a lawn in Cyprus?

Only with eyes open: a lawn needs daily summer irrigation, and water is metered and increasingly expensive on the island. Many villa owners are replacing lawns with gravel gardens, native planting, and artificial turf. If you want real grass, warm-season varieties (bermuda) plus a proper irrigation system are the minimum — budget the running cost, not just the installation.
